Detox Programs for Alberta Teens

Original Air Date: Tuesday, July 17, 2012

Parents in Alberta can now obtain a court order to keep their teenagers in detox for up to fifteen days, up from the previous five.

Some parents applaud the changes to Alberta’s Protection of Children Abusing Drugs Act, others say the five to ten additional days of mandatory treatment is negligible without longer term follow up.

Should parents have the right to force their children into detox?  Is it the right way to treat addicted teens?

Joining us for this discussion is Mark Cherrington, Youth Justice Advocate; Maralyn Benay, Founding Member of Parents Empowering Parents; and Madelyn McDonald, Street Services Program Manager at Wood's Homes, a children's mental health centre.
